Kenshi Sankoda is a scholar working on Health, Toxicology and Mutagenesis, Pollution and Materials Chemistry. According to data from OpenAlex, Kenshi Sankoda has authored 24 papers receiving a total of 377 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Health, Toxicology and Mutagenesis, 9 papers in Pollution and 5 papers in Materials Chemistry. Recurrent topics in Kenshi Sankoda’s work include Microplastics and Plastic Pollution (6 papers), Toxic Organic Pollutants Impact (5 papers) and Water Treatment and Disinfection (4 papers). Kenshi Sankoda is often cited by papers focused on Microplastics and Plastic Pollution (6 papers), Toxic Organic Pollutants Impact (5 papers) and Water Treatment and Disinfection (4 papers). Kenshi Sankoda collaborates with scholars based in Japan and United States. Kenshi Sankoda's co-authors include Kazuhiko Sekiguchi, Kei Nomiyama, Ryota Shinohara, Norikazu Namiki, Susumu Nii, Kotaro Murata, Kengo Suzuki, Jun Kobayashi, Masato Ito and Akio Inoue and has published in prestigious journals such as Environmental Science & Technology, Journal of Hazardous Materials and Environmental Pollution.
